- Enrollment on Arrival, which can be done while clearing immigration during international return to the US: Global Entry Enrollment on Arrival
- Some locations offer walk-in interviews even if you do not have an appointment: Global Entry Walk-In Interviews
- If you will be passing through MIA, their GE office nearly always has immediate availability and is open very late.
Note also that a location that has literally zero availability for future interviews today, may pop up with available slots tomorrow (or even later today), presumably as people with scheduled appointments do EOA or walk-in thus freeing up their original time slot. So it may be worth checking back periodically.

I merged your question into the thread discussing GE interview appointments availability.
Take a look at @JAGorham's post from last month, it probably answers your question.
RIC has very spotty availability; I think it's listed as a seasonal facility. I managed to get a mid-August appointment (about 7 weeks out from approval), but when I looked later on for potential earlier dates, everything was filled up. IAD has some pretty quick availability right now, about a week out.
